Abstract: | A search for the decay K0S→μ+μ− is performed, based on a data sample of 1.0 fb−1 of pp collisions at s√=7TeV collected by the LHCb experiment at the Large Hadron Collider. The observed number of candidates is consistent with the background-only hypothesis, yielding an upper limit of B(K0S→μ+μ−) < 11(9) × 10−9 at 95 (90)% confidence level. This limit is a factor of thirty below the previous measurement. |
